Listing Description

As a Security Construction Consultant, you will be essential to furthering our mission by providing expert solutions to clients, enhancing client satisfaction through ongoing technical support, and assisting the consulting team in evolving the security capabilities of the organization and our clients.


This role will:



  • Evaluate clients’ existing security protocols, technologies, and processes and identify obstacles and deficiencies in meeting ICD705 accreditation requirements.

  • Provide expert guidance to clients on best practices, industry standards, and regulatory frameworks related to ICD705 accreditation.

  • Work closely with clients to design and develop tailored solutions to address their specific ICD705 accreditation challenges.

  • Oversee the successful implementation of recommended solutions, including the installation, configuration, and integration of security systems, encryption technologies, physical access controls, and other relevant measures.

  • Offer ongoing technical support and troubleshooting services to clients, resolving any system-related issues or concerns that arise during the accreditation process.

  • Maintain accurate documentation of client engagements, including project plans, implementation details, issue resolutions, and post-implementation evaluations.

  • Stay informed about the latest developments, trends, and updates in ICD705 accreditation standards and related technologies.


This role might be a good fit for you if you have:



  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ience.

  • In-depth knowledge and understanding of ICD705 accreditation standards, policies, and procedures.

  • Proven experience in consulting or providing technical solutions for security-related projects, preferably within government or defense sectors.

  • The ability to understand typical construction installation methods and how to integrate ICD 705 security features into construction designs.

  • A strong understanding of information security principles, physical security controls, encryption methods, and relevant technologies.

  • The ability to evaluate security risks, conduct vulnerability assessments, and provide appropriate remedies.

  • Exceptional problem-solving and critical-thinking skills, with the ability to analyze complex situations and deliver effective solutions.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ively communicate technical concepts to clients and stakeholders.

  • The 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in a detail-oriented and highly organized manner.

  • The ability to travel up to 30% of the year.

  • Expert level skills with Microsoft Word, Excel, and Project.
